After 20 years we get the sequel to Independence Day (1996), Independence Day: Resurgence. Roland Emmerich, who is famously known for his big disaster-films like Independence Day (1996), The Day After Tomorrow (2004) and 2012 (2009). After 20 years of preparation for the next alien-attack, earth is attacked by an a hostile alien-ship and must now defend itself with modern weapon. Jeff Goldblum is back, as well as Bill Pullman from the original cast, but Will Smith is missing, which was smart of him because this movie is not needed at all. The story is a mashup one of the original, there is no heart and specially good humour in the movie and there are no characters you really care about. A few good scenes with Jeff Goldblum can’t save this movie. The main focus here was obviously the visual effects which looks quite good, apart from the aliens which seems very generic and lacks texture. This movie will earn back its budget and even hints at more sequels to come. Lets hope they will be a lot better than this generic piece of a film.

Score: 4/10
